City accepts $1 million DOE grant to kick-start electric vehicle charging network

San Francisco Board of Supervisors Budget & Finance Subcommittee · June 9, 2010

The Department of the Environment told supervisors it will accept $1,000,000 from the U.S. Department of Energy to install EV chargers in city garages, fund curbside charging, pilot a taxi battery-switch station and add two grant-funded positions; the city will match and leverage additional grants totaling about $1.2 million.

San Francisco — The Budget & Finance Subcommittee voted to forward a resolution authorizing the Department of the Environment to accept and expend a $1,000,000 federal grant from the U.S. Department of Energy to support the San Francisco Electric Vehicle Initiative.
